#e7316c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7316c is composed of 90.6% red, 19.2%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#e7316c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62d8 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#e7316c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e7316c has RGB values of R:231, G:49,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.53,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15151468.

Hex triplet e7316c #e7316c
RGB Decimal 231, 49, 108 rgb(231,49,108)
RGB Percent 90.6, 19.2, 42.4 rgb(90.6%,19.2%,42.4%)
CMYK 0, 79, 53, 9
HSL 340.5°, 79.1, 54.9 hsl(340.5,79.1%,54.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.5°, 78.8, 90.6
Web Safe ff3366 #ff3366
CIE-LAB 52.144, 70.573, 11.591
XYZ 36.761, 20.272, 16.164
xyY 0.502, 0.277, 20.272
CIE-LCH 52.144, 71.518, 9.327
CIE-LUV 52.144, 121.908, 0.192
Hunter-Lab 45.025, 66.946, 10.232
Binary 11100111, 00110001, 01101100

Shades and Tints of #e7316c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fef2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7316c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f898b is the less saturated color, while #f91f66 is the most saturated one.
